Flat roof replacement projects in Middletown, CT, typically involve assessing the existing roof, selecting suitable materials, and ensuring proper installation to prevent leaks and extend the roof’s lifespan. Understanding the scope and options can help homeowners and property managers plan effectively for this essential upgrade.
- Materials: Common options include membrane systems like EPDM, TPO, or PVC, each offering different durability and cost profiles suited for flat roofs.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small commercial flat roofs to larger residential sections, affecting overall project complexity and duration.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ires specialized techniques to ensure a proper seal and prevent future leaks, which can influence labor costs and timeframes.
- Permitting: Local Middletown permits may be necessary, especially for larger or structural modifications, and should be factored into project planning.
- Additional Options: Considerations may include insulation upgrades, drainage improvements, or the addition of reflective coatings to enhance roof performance.

Flat Roof Replacement Services
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ential flat roof (up to 1,000 sq ft) | $5,000 - $10,000 |
| Medium-sized commercial flat roof (1,000 - 5,000 sq ft) | $10,000 - $30,000 |
| Large flat roof (over 5,000 sq ft) | $30,000 - $100,000+ |
| Roof removal and disposal | $1,500 - $5,000 |
| Additional repairs or insulation | Varies based on scope |
In Middletown, CT, flat roof replacement costs can vary based on roof size, material choice, and existing conditions.
